DHL Supply Chain, the specialized contract logistics division of DHL Group, is expanding its presence in the Rhineland economic region. The company is building a new 26,600 m² carbon-neutral logistics center at the Wolbersacker industrial park in Rheinbach. The facility is scheduled to go live in August 2026.

The new center will provide modern warehousing and transshipment space to meet rising demand for high-performance logistics solutions. It is designed to improve supply chain efficiency and flexibility for companies in the region.

Key Features and Benefits:

* **Carbon-Neutral Design:** The facility follows the Gold Standard of the German Sustainable Building Council (DGNB).
* **Energy Efficiency:** Includes a 1.0 MWp photovoltaic system, 229 kW battery storage, efficient heat pumps, and energy-optimized LED lighting.
* **Modular Space:** The warehouse can support conventional storage, e-commerce fulfillment, or automated solutions.
* **Strategic Location:** Close to the A61 motorway, Cologne/Bonn Airport, and Düsseldorf Airport, enabling faster domestic and European deliveries.
